The Tema Regional Police Command has launched a manhunt for a group of armed robbers who shot and killed a 68-year-old during an attack at a drinking spot opposite the Tema Community 9 Cemetery on Friday, November 7.
According to a statement issued by the head of Public Affairs ASP Dede Dzakpasu, preliminary investigations indicate that the victim was sitting with several others when six young men arrived at the venue on two motorbikes.
“Two of the assailants approached the group, and one of them snatched the victim’s mobile phone from the table. When the victim attempted to retrieve his phone, one of the suspects shot, and the gang fled the scene on their motorbikes,” the police said.
The victim was rushed to the Tema General Hospital, where he was pronounced dead shortly after arrival. A 9mm spent shell was recovered from the scene and has been processed for evidential purposes.
Police confirmed that witnesses present at the time of the incident have been interviewed to assist with the ongoing investigation.
The service stated that a full-scale operation has been launched to track down those responsible.
“The Tema Regional Police Command has launched a full-scale operation to track down the perpetrators,” the statement read.
“Efforts are ongoing to contact the British Embassy to officially notify them of the death of their national. The Command assures the public that every effort is being made to arrest the suspects and bring them to justice.”
